DERRY, N.H. (AP) – Two police cruisers collided in Derry, N.H. on the Route 28 bypass on their way to serve an arrest warrant.
WMUR reports one officer suffered minor injuries Wednesday. The cruisers had minor damage.
Police said the cruisers were on their way to serve an arrest warrant when officers in one car saw another vehicle speeding in the other direction. When that officer reversed direction to stop the speeder, the cruisers collided.
Both cars were towed from the scene, and an accident reconstruction team was investigating the collision.
